[Ethereum Spot ETF Had a Net Outflow of $500 Million Last Week, Marking the Third Consecutive Week of Net Outflows] According to SoSoValue data, from November 17 to November 21 (Eastern Time), Ethereum spot ETFs experienced a weekly net outflow of $500 million, marking the third consecutive week of net outflows. The Ethereum spot ETF with the highest net inflow last week was the Grayscale Ethereum Mini Trust ETF (ETH), with a weekly net inflow of $80.88 million and a historical cumulative net inflow of $1.424 billion. The second highest was the Bitwise ETF (ETHW), with a weekly net inflow of $14.19 million and a historical cumulative net inflow of $399 million. The ETF with the largest net outflow was the BlackRock ETF (ETHA), with a weekly net outflow of $559 million and a historical cumulative net inflow of $12.89 billion. The second largest net outflow was recorded by the Grayscale Ethereum Trust ETF (ETHE), with a weekly net outflow of $31.82 million and a historical cumulative net outflow of $4.92 billion. As of press time, the total net asset value of Ethereum spot ETFs stands at $16.86 billion, with an ETF net asset ratio of 5.10%, and a historical cumulative net inflow of $12.63 billion.
